Admittedly I dont run one myself, but looking through our timeslip registry's here on the site there are quite a few Ebay turbo's running some pretty respectable times. While people may not care for them, others seem to be pretty pleased with the performance they're getting out of them.

Frankly I'm a fan of anything that works, and works well, and the cheaper the better. Ideally as these turbo's improve quality wise, and start posting faster times we'll see the name-brand turbo's stop rediculously overcharging just because XYZ shop put their name on a newfangled superduper design that is really just a generic design re-badged.

It's kinda funny the difference in import communities vs. domestic. Domestics want to go fast on the smallest budget they can manage most of the time. Within our community you're almost dismissed and not taken seriously, no matter how fast the car is, if it's not running the newest latest greatest and most expensive setup. Not ranting or venting, to each their own. Just making a humourous observation between the two communities.
